Job Description:

A vital role of the CMO Administration team, the Medical Peer Reviewer plays a critical role in consulting on medical necessity in the context of utilization management and ensuring adherence to internal Healthfirst and external regulations.

Job Responsibility:

  • Assess/review requests for authorization, and claims payment, based on medical records and internal Healthfirst information and make informed clinical judgments and recommendations
  • Render determinations in the format and within timeframes to follow Regulatory and Operational policies
  • Maintain productivity standards
  • Collaborate with Utilization Management and Care Management and medical departments as needed, reviews and manages cases/caseload from multiple lines of businesses
  • Demonstrate the ability to be flexible when case load volume fluxes and when Leadership requests changes in case priorities to support our members/internal medical departments as needed
  • Complete mandatory Company compliance training and training in new systems and software
  • Enter each day’s hours worked in Workday, on the same day
  • Perform other duties as assigned

Requirements:

  • Licensed M.D. or D.O. or D.M.D. or D.D.S.
  • Board Certified in a specialty recognized by the American Board of Medical Specialties

Nice to have:

  • New York State Board Certified in Internal Medicine or Family Practice
  • Previous, relevant experience in utilization management and clinical practice
  • Knowledge of Medicare, Medicaid, and MLTC plans
  • Time management, critical thinking, communication, and problem-solving skills
  • Knowledge of UM/QM case philosophies and reporting requirements to state and federal agencies
  • Knowledge of member satisfaction/incident management and regulations
  • Knowledge of quality improvement methodologies
